J&K records 83 fresh Covid-19 cases

Srinagar: Jammu and Kashmir reported 83 new COVID-19 cases on Thursday, taking the infection tally in the Union territory to 4,55,089, officials said here.

No fresh death due to the infection was reported in the region, they said.

While 59 cases were reported from Jammu division, 24 cases were reported from Kashmir valley, officials said.

Providing district-wise breakup for positive cases for today, the officials said that Jammu district reported 49 cases; Srinagar 19; Samba, Poonch, Udhampur and Baramulla reported  02 cases each; Kathua reported 03 cases and; Rajouri, Budgam, Kulgam and Kupwara reported 01 case each.

The COVID-19 death toll has reached 4,756, they said.

There are 493 active cases of the disease, while the number of recoveries has reached 4,49,840, they said.

The officials added that there are 51 confirmed cases of mucormycosis (black fungus).

The officials further said that 10,221 doses of Covid vaccine have been administered in the last 24 hours bringing the cumulative number of doses administered across J&K to 2,32,87,05.

Active COVID-19 cases cross one lakh mark in India

India logged over 18,000 new coronavirus infections in a single day after a gap of 130 days, taking the COVID-19 tally to 4,34,52,164, according to the Union Health Ministry data updated on Thursday.

The active cases crossed the one lakh mark again after 122 days.

A total 18,819 new Covid cases were reported in a span of 24 hours while the death toll climbed to 5,25,116 with 39 new fatalities, the data updated at 8 am stated.

The active cases increased to 1,04,555 comprising 0.24 per cent of the total infections, while the national COVID-19 recovery rate was recorded at 98.55 per cent, the ministry said.

An increase of 4,953 cases has been recorded in the active COVID-19 caseload in a span of 24 hours.

The daily positivity rate was recorded at 4.16 per cent and the weekly positivity rate at 3.72 per cent, according to the ministry.

The number of people who have recuperated from the disease surged to        4,28,22,493, while the case fatality rate was 1.21 per cent.

According to the ministry, 197.61 crore doses of Covid vaccine have been administered in the country so far under the nationwide COVID-19 vaccination drive.
